INTERRELATIONSHIP OF BUILDING AND SURROUNDINGS: (Indicate if building or structure is in an historic district) Located in a low-medium density residential area of Main Rd. , historic Kings Hwy. , the east-west route through East Marion. Surrounded by houses of similiar and earl- ier date , especially to the east along Main Rd. 18. OTHER NOTABLE FEATURES OF BUILDING AND SITE (including interior features if known): 21 story, 3 bay, side entrance plan, gable roof L-shaped house. 2 story semi-hexagonal bay window on west . Varieg- ated shingles in gable peak. Semi-wraparound porch on main facade with turned posts and small decorative spandrels . 2/2 windows , double leaf entrance door. SIGNIFICANCE 19_ DATE OF INITIAL CONSTRUCTION: circa 1900 ARCHITECT: BUILDER: 10. HISTORICAL AND ARCHITECTURAL INIPORTANCF: This house contributes to the ambience of this historic roadscape. 21.
